Scandinavian Tobacco Group Tobacco Service B.V. is seeking a passionate Sales Representative for Scotland North (Dundee) to join its UK team. In this field-based role, you will promote innovative Next Generation Products (NGP) and cultivate strong relationships with independent retailers.
The ideal candidate will have:
- a sales background
- experience with store-level data
- a full UK driving licence
A competitive salary and generous benefits are on offer, including a company car and private healthcare.
